Özet

We suggest a generalized procedure to obtain exactly solvable position-dependent mass Hamiltonians in one dimension. The second-order Casimir invariant of the regular representation of a non-compact semi-simple Lie group G, the spectral properties of which are well known, is used to introduce exactly solvable Hamiltonians. A brief description of the procedure is presented and its application to quantum systems associated with SL(2, R) is detailed.
